Greg Boyce v Inner West Council [2017] NSWLEC 1268

Greg Boyce v Inner West Council [2017] NSWLEC 1268

The appeal is upheld and the development application is approved as the parties reached an agreement at conciliation conference acceptable to the Court under s 34(3) of the Land and Environment Court Act 1979.
